We are looking to add a Senior Manager, Financial Planning & Analysis to our team. If you enjoy working in a startup environment and are passionate about making an impact in a growing company, we would like to hear from you. 

In this position, you will manage financial planning, forecasting, budgeting, and performance analysis activities that support organizational objectives and financial performance. This role leads planning cycles, financial modeling, management reporting, and business analysis, providing financial insights and recommendations that support operational and strategic decision-making.

Working cross-functionally with finance, accounting, operations, program management, and executive leadership, this role aligns financial plans with business priorities, evaluates performance, and supports resource allocation decisions that strengthen financial execution and organizational performance.

JOB D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Lead annual budgeting, forecasting, and long-range planning activities by establishing assumptions, timelines, and financial targets aligned with business objectives.
  • Evaluate financial and operational performance to identify trends, risks, and opportunities and recommend actions that improve forecast accuracy and business performance.
  • Develop financial models and scenario analyses that support resource planning, investment decisions, and changes in business conditions.
  • Partner with functional and program leaders to evaluate financial results, cost drivers, and performance against plan and translate findings into actionable recommendations.
  • Direct preparation of management reporting, dashboards, variance analyses, and financial presentations that provide visibility into business performance.
  • Advise leadership on financial implications of operational decisions, business cases, investments, and resource requirements to support informed decision-making.
  • Manage and develop FP&A professionals by establishing priorities, assigning responsibilities, and providing coaching and performance feedback.
  • Establish team objectives and performance expectations that align FP&A activities with finance and organizational priorities.
  • Foster accountability, collaboration, and continuous improvement while strengthening financial analysis and planning capabilities across the team.
  • Lead improvements to forecasting methodologies, financial models, reporting processes, and planning workflows to increase accuracy, efficiency, and scalability.
  • Establish consistent FP&A practices, assumptions, and reporting standards that strengthen data integrity and financial governance.
  • Evaluate planning processes and analytical capabilities to identify automation and standardization opportunities that improve financial decision support.
